How they compare
Romania currently reports 7.27 against 7.19 in Bolivia, Plurinational State of, a difference of 0.08.
Across all 25 years both countries report, Romania has been ahead every year.
Bolivia, Plurinational State of ranks 34th and Romania ranks 32nd of 89 countries.
Romania has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bolivia, Plurinational State of | Romania |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 17.06 | 65.97 | 48.91 | Romania |
| 2000s | 8.26 | 20.49 | 12.23 | Romania |
| 2010s | 0.6581 | 4.62 | 3.96 | Romania |
| 2020s | 3.66 | 7.4 | 3.74 | Romania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
